The concept of a natural morphogenic geoecosystem was used to model the vegetation in the GIS environment. The edaphic factors used in modeling included landform elements characteristics (slope and concavity/convexity) as well as the soil and the parent rock properties that define drainage. The climatic factors influencing the distribution of the vegetation embraced annual sums of precipitation and of active temperature. The information about the ecological interrelations between the factors and the vegetation was taken from the regional literature as well as from the field observations.
